Mam problem z zapisywaniem przez Squida logów w pliku access.log. Plik /etc/squid/squid.conf wygląda następująco:
Kod: Zaznacz cały
#ilosc ramu
cache_mem 100 MB
# Maksymalny rozmiar pliku
maximum_object_size 200 MB
maximum_object_size_in_memory 1 MB
# Minimalny rozmiar obiektu
minimum_object_size 0 KB
ipcache_size 10240
ipcache_low 90
ipcache_high 95
cache_access_log /var/log/squid/access.log
cache_store_log /var/log/squid/access.log
#wlacza rotacje logow
logfile_rotate 0
http_port 3128 transparent
error_directory /usr/share/squid/errors/Polish
#nazwa komputera rutera
visible_hostname debian
log_fqdn on
log_mime_hdrs on
#ident_lookup_access allow all localhost SSL_ports Safe_ports CONNECT
#user proxy
cache_effective_user nobody
#1000 oznacza 1000mb dysku dla squida
# Chce mieć 6GB cache (mam na dysku 16GB wolnego)
# Liczba Å›rodkowa w parametrze cache_dir to liczba katalogÃłw pierwszego poziomu.
# Wyliczamy ją dzieląc miejsce przeznaczone na cache przez średnią wielkość obiektu,
# a nastepnie wynik jeszcze raz dzielimy przez 32. Przykładowo:
# Liczba katalogÃłw pierwszego poziomu = (6144 / (16 * 32))
cache_dir ufs /squid_cache/ 10000 100 256
#na jakim poziomie zapełnienia ma pracować cache dyskowe
cache_swap_low 90%
cache_swap_high 95%
#dla archaicznych internet exploderÃłw
ie_refresh on
# udostepnianie proxy dla wszystkich
#http_access deny blok_plikow
#http_access deny blok_reklam
#http_access allow all
#######################################
acl all src 192.168.0.0/255.255.255.0
http_access allow all
#acl blok_plikow urlpath_regex "/etc/squid/pliki.acl"
#acl blok_reklam url_regex "/etc/squid/reklamy.acl"
acl manager proto cache_object
# acl localhost src 127.0.0.1/255.255.255.255
acl SSL_ports port 443 563
acl Safe_ports port 21 70 80 210 443 563 1025-65535
acl purge method PURGE
acl CONNECT method CONNECT
acl intranet src 192.168.0.0/24
# Anonimowosc na uzytkownikow za NAT
# forwarded_for off
icp_access allow all
miss_access allow all
cache_mgr administrator(małpa)domena.pl
#######################################
vary_ignore_expire on
relaxed_header_parser on
request_header_max_size 50 KB
refresh_pattern -i \.(gif|jpg|jpeg|png|html|bmp) 4320 90% 43200 reload-into-ims
refresh_pattern -i \.(zip|gz|bz2|exe|rar|mp3|mpg|avi|wmv|vqf|ogg) 43200 100% 43200 reload-into-ims
refresh_pattern windowsupdate.com/.*\.(cab|exe|dll) 43200 100% 43200 reload-into-ims
refresh_pattern download.microsoft.com/.*\.(cab|exe|dll) 43200 100% 43200 reload-into-ims
refresh_pattern au.download.windowsupdate.com/.*\.(cab|exe|dll) 43200 100% 43200 reload-into-ims
refresh_pattern symantecliveupdate.com/.*\.(zip|exe) 43200 100% 43200 reload-into-ims
refresh_pattern windowsupdate.com/.*\.(cab|exe) 43200 100% 43200 reload-into-ims
refresh_pattern download.microsoft.com/.*\.(cab|exe) 43200 100% 43200 reload-into-ims
refresh_pattern avast.com/.*\.(vpu|vpaa) 43200 100% 43200 reload-into-ims
refresh_pattern . 0 90% 43200 reload-into-ims
collapsed_forwarding off
refresh_stale_hit 100 seconds
half_closed_clients on
# ident_timeout 1 seconds